Description
An original pastel and pencil painting by Dale Burlison De Armond (Sitka, Alaska 1914-2006). The portrait painting depicts a Tlingit / Inuit man dressed in a ceremonial potlatch costume. Note attached to the reverse of the portrait reads in-part.." Old medicine man wearing a copper ceremonial hat. The bird's head is of carved yellow cedar with a copper eye.." Artist signed in pencil. Measures 13.5" x 10.5". Framed under glass, 16" x 13".
NOTE: DeArmond's paintings are quite scarce.
PROVENANCE: From the Horace Willard "H.W" Nagley family collection.
